30 studes ‘possessed’

-

BANSALAN, DAVAO DEL SUR – Around 30 high school students of Marber National High School in Km. 84, Barangay Marber were believed to have been possessed by evil spirits on Tuesday which prompted teachers to immediatel­y suspend classes.

The possessed stu- dents reportedly started shouting inside the classroom while their voices changed and they went berserk.

The alleged possession reportedly started around 10 a.m. but this was later controlled after some of the students were brought to the nearest hospitals and attended by physicians. Catholic Church catechist also responded and prayed for them.

Delarey Florentino, school principal, told Sun.Star Superbalit­a that another possession happened which affected at least 15 third year and fourth year students.

He said that some students regained consciousn­ess at the hospital while some others were taken to the Immaculate Conception Parish.

Miriam Molina narrated that issues on possession started last Monday in one of their classrooms but it was immediatel­y blessed by a ‘Pangulo sa Liturhiya (President of Liturgy).

The incident prompted school officials to also suspend night classes but it resumed yesterday after a Holy Mass was offered by Faculty members.

Molina said the school compound is surrounded by big and old trees that were cut during the constructi­on of the new twostorey building where the possessed students where holding classes.

Now that the new building was already blessed, teachers of the school are hoping that the bad spirits leave the place.
